Traymore Nursing Center in Dallas is best suited for families seeking a warm, home-like atmosphere with visible leadership, attentive bedside care, and solid rehab support during a recovery or transitional phase. When a loved one is coming out of hospital care or entering end-of-life plans, Traymore can feel like a reassuring harbor: the building is described as clean and welcoming, and families repeatedly highlight the patient-to-staff interactions as the facility's strength. The best cases are those where a proactive, communicative team - often centered on a hands-on manager or social worker - can guide families through admissions, care milestones, and, when needed, hospice coordination. In short, it serves well those prioritizing personal attention, clear updates, and a sense of "home" during a stressful time.
Yet the community warrants caution for families prioritizing unflinching reliability and flawless daily operations. Several reviews flag inconsistent responsiveness, difficulty obtaining timely call-backs, and administrative friction. Some accounts allege rude or overwhelmed front-line staff, with particular concern about how discharge planning, medication coordination, and transportation are managed. The Park Cities campus in particular has produced strongly negative anecdotes - claims of neglect, dirty conditions, and unsafe gaps in care. While not universal, these reports underscore the reality that experience can hinge on location-level leadership and staffing patterns, not just the facility's overall image.
The strongest pros - competent, compassionate staff, active leadership, and robust family communication - often offset the larger drawbacks when management is engaged and present. Instances where a manager or social worker steps in to facilitate admissions, coordinate hospice services, or answer questions promptly can transform a stressful period into a manageable, even positive one. Families frequently praise Octavia, the DON, and social workers who stay accessible, explain procedures, and keep families informed through transitions. The rehab and therapy offers, along with proximity to a major medical center, also help families feel confident that skilled attention is available when mobility and functional goals need to be advanced.
However, the variability between campuses cannot be ignored. Positive testimonials about cleanliness, quiet rooms, and friendly, abundant staff contrast sharply with bitter critiques about odors, inconsistent housekeeping, and slow response times. Food quality, recreation, and activity levels receive mixed reviews as well, with some residents enjoying meals and engagement, while others report cold dishes, limited menus, or a lack of meaningful daytime structure. This inconsistency reinforces the need for careful, on-site observation and direct conversations with current residents and families - ideally through multiple visits - to determine whether the day-to-day environment will meet expectations.
For families evaluating Traymore, concrete due diligence is essential. Tour the facility at different times to observe staffing patterns during peak hours, request to meet the DON and a social worker, and ask for recent quality indicators, incident reports, and the current plan for any needed specialty care (wound care, ostomy support, pain management). Inspect cleanliness and odor, the state of linens and bathrooms, and the level of noise and activity that could affect rest. Confirm which campus is being considered, understand the nursing ratio in rehab vs long-term care, and verify the agility of discharge planning and pharmacy coordination. If hospice or post-acute rehab is anticipated, probe the facility's partnerships and the process for family notification.

Traymore Nursing Center in Dallas, TX is an assisted living community that offers a wide range of amenities and care services to ensure the comfort and well-being of its residents. The community provides a variety of amenities including a beauty salon, cable or satellite TV, dining room, fitness room, gaming room, garden, kitchenette, outdoor space, small library, telephone, Wi-Fi/high-speed internet access, and more.
Residents at Traymore Nursing Center also have access to various care services such as 24-hour call system and supervision, assistance with activities of daily living including bathing and dressing, assistance with transfers, medication management, diabetes diet monitoring and meal preparation services. The center also has a mental wellness program to cater to the emotional and psychological needs of its residents.
The dining options at Traymore Nursing Center are designed to accommodate special dietary restrictions. The on-site restaurant-style dining ensures that residents receive nutritious meals prepared by professional chefs.
To keep residents engaged and active, the community offers concierge services along with fitness programs for physical wellbeing. Planned day trips provide opportunities for residents to explore the surrounding areas while resident-run activities and scheduled daily activities foster a sense of community and social interaction.

In-Depth Look at the VA Aid and Attendance Program
The VA Aid and Attendance program offers financial assistance to veterans needing help with daily activities due to health issues, available through a pension for low-income wartime veterans or an allowance for 100% disabled individuals. Eligibility depends on medical documentation of care needs and navigating guidelines about income and service history, with funds being usable for various healthcare-related expenses.
